Power Ge'ez 2010 is not compatible with Excel 2013. What can I do?

Power Ge'ez 2010 it is a utility developed by Concepts Data Systems that allows you to type Amharic on Windows applications. It is compatible with Office 97, Office 2000, Office 2003, Office 2007 and Office 2010. In order to type Amharic on Microsoft Excel 2013 documents, I suggest you download and install Google Input Tools - Amharic. Navigate to the official web page, check the box next to Amharic, and click Download. Install the tool following the on-screen instructions and open your Excel 2013 document. Click the Click to view icon from System Tray and select AM Amharic (Ethiopia) instead of EN.
Power Ge'ez 2010 is not working properly with Excel 2013. It's OK with Word 2013. Is there any way to resolve the issue?

The application is not available anymore which means the support is practically nonexistent. If you managed to run the application, it's pure luck. Compatibility is at minimum. However, if you have the application, right click it and change its compatibility to a previous version of Windows. This will ensure that compatibility is somewhat increased. After this process attempt to work with the software and Excel. Unfortunately, it's the only way for a discontinued application.
